Using an Android device, you may already know about the Always-on Display feature. The Always-on Display feature was first introduced by Samsung, which took advantage of their phone’s AMOLED Display.

Always on Display is a feature that has the device continue to show specific information even when the screen is turned off. On Android, you can view the time, date, notifications, missed calls, etc., when the phone is in sleep mode.

At first, the feature is only limited to Samsung devices with AMOLED display, but now it’s available on almost every mid to high-end device. If you are a big fan of the Always-on Display feature, you might want to add new clock faces, visual elements, etc., to your always-on display screen.

5 Best Always On Display Apps for Android (2022)

So, if you are looking for ways to customize the always-on display functionality of your Android device, you need to start using these third-party customization apps.

1) Always On AMOLED

Always On AMOLED

This is an app that adds the Always-On display feature to your smartphone. Although the app is designed for phones with AMOLED displays, it runs fine on every device. So, you can use this app if your phone doesn’t have the Always-On display.

With Always On AMOLED, you can keep your screen on all the time and view information about time, date, notifications, and more without touching your device. You can even add music controls, weather widgets, etc., to your always-on-display screen on Android.

2) AOA: Always on Display

AOA: Always on Display

If your phone has an AMOLED display, and if you are looking for ways to customize the Always On the Display screen, give AOA: Always on Display a try. It’s an app that adds edge lighting, clock, date, current weather, music control, and more elements on your Android’s always-on display screen.

AOA: Always on Display is entirely free to download & use, and it’s designed to use 0% of your CPU and low system resources. However, your phone will only achieve this if it has an AMOLED display. On a non-AMOLED display, the app will drain the battery life.

3) Always On: Edge Music Lighting

Always On: Edge Music Lighting

Always On: Edge Music Lighting, also known as Muviz Edge, differs from all other Always On Display apps listed in the article. It’s an app that displays a live music visualizer around the edges of the screen while listening to music.

This app is designed for music lovers and includes many always-on-display designs. All of the always-on-display designs look unique and feature a music player that syncs the animation and the music.

4) NotifyBuddy


Well, NotifyBuddy is very different from other always-on-display apps on the list. This one utilizes the always-on-display technology to bring LED notification light to any smartphone.

If you have a phone with an AMOLED display, you can use NotifyBuddy to enable the notification LED feature on a per-app basis. Once you configure the apps, when the app sends you the notification, NotifyBuddy will bring in a black screen and show you the Notification LED.

NotifyBuddy also offers you a few additional features, such as choosing your favorite icons for the LED, selecting the custom colors, and more.

5) Always On Edge

Always On Edge

If you search for the best app to customize the always-on display screen, try On Edge. This one is a full-fledged customization app for Android that provides many features.

With Always-On Edge, you can enable LED notification light, edge lighting, ambient display, etc. The app even allows you to add widgets such as notifications icons, battery status, etc., to the always-on display screen.

You can even set the app to show widgets along with edge lighting and led notification when the device is locked.

So, these are some of the best Always-on display apps that you can use on your Android smartphone. Yes, there are other apps for AOD customization, but we have listed only the free ones. If you know of any other always-on display apps for Android, let us know in the comments.


Please enter your comment!
Please enter your name here